TOP TEN TOP TEN SCHOLARS OF '81' Melanie Rockwood, Ceilicia Amaro, Deanna Ugaki, Kenneth Goodworth, Melanie Darrington, Chris Sol- lars, Kelly Nakmura, Deserae Goble, Bonnie Orchard, and Mike Rivers. 42 HONOR STUDENTS CONTRIBUTED TO THE GRADUATION CEREMONY Mike Rivers led the Pledge of Allegiance, Invocation was given by Melanie Darrington, and Deanna Ugaki welcomed the graduates, their families and friends. The past, present, and future were themes that the student speakers addressed. Bonnie Orchard spoke on the theme of yesterday; Chris Sollars, today; and Kelly Nakamura, tomorrow. Melanie Rockwood introduced the speaker, Melba Rae Barnett. Kenneth Coodworth acknowledged the support of the community, and Cecilia Amaro gave a tribute to family support. Deserae Coble gave the closing Benediction. 43 44 The Senior Ball was held at the Blacktoot Elks Lodge on the evening of May 18,1981. Circulation - IKK) 160 YOUTH LEGISLATURE The following people from Tri-Hi-Y went to the 1981 session of Youth Legisla- ture in Boise April 30, May 1 and 2: Melanie Rockwood — Representative loelene Hunt — Senator Karen Ugaki — Secretary to the Lt. Coverner Karen Malm — Lobbyist They were accompanied by Mrs. Maude Owens, advisor of the club. The club prepared a bill to be consid- ered at the Youth Legislature which would have to be presented and debated in both the House and the Senate. Also, Melanie Rockwood and Jolene Hunt participated in debating, both pro and con bills from other schools in the state of Idaho. Karen Ugaki handled all the Lt. Coverner's secre- tarial duties in the Senate, and Karen Malm acted as a Lobbyist to get our bill passed. At the noon luncheon on Saturday awards were presented to the Youth Gov- ernment officials from throughout the state. For the very first time advisors were hon- ored. Mrs. Owens received a bronze pla- que reading: Maude Owens for 20 years of Dedicated and Outstanding Service to Youth Legislature 1981 This and all other awards were conferred by justice Charles Donaldson of the State Supreme Court, who is also the Chairman of the YMCA Youth and Government Committee.
